Glossy Clear PPF

A high-clarity, high-gloss finish that enhances your vehicle’s original paint while staying virtually invisible. Ideal for customers who want maximum shine and factory-like appearance.

  • True gloss finish with no distortion
  • Self-healing surface removes light swirls and scratches
  • Great for full-body or panel-specific protection

Matte PPF (Stealth Finish)

Transform any glossy paint into a modern matte look while preserving its color and protecting it from damage. Perfect for luxury vehicles or clients seeking a unique aesthetic.

  • Smooth matte finish with a non-reflective appearance
  • Same protection performance with a stealthy look
  • Great for dark-colored or matte factory finishes

⚙️ Technical Specifications

Feature Details
Material Lubrizol TPU (Thermoplastic Polyurethane)
Finish Options Glossy Clear, Matte
Thickness 7.5 mil 
Self-Healing Yes – with heat or sunlight
UV Protection Yes
Adhesive Pressure-sensitive, repositionable
Chemical Resistance Yes (resists bird droppings, sap, bug acids)
Application Wet install (compatible with plotters or bulk hand-cut)
Roll Sizes 60" x 50’, 30" x 50’, per foot
Warranty 8 years

Q: What's the difference between ceramic, carbon, and dyed window film? +
A: Ceramic film offers the highest heat rejection (up to 97% infrared) and UV protection using nano-ceramic technology with zero signal interference—ideal for premium installations. Carbon film provides excellent heat rejection and UV protection without fading, at a mid-range price point. Dyed film is the most economical option, offering privacy and glare reduction for budget-conscious customers.
Q: How much film do I need for my vehicle? +
A: Window tint typically requires 10-15 feet of film for a sedan, 15-20 feet for an SUV. For PPF, a full front coverage (hood, fenders, bumper, mirrors) requires approximately 15-20 feet depending on vehicle size. Pre-cut kits are sized specifically for your vehicle make and model. Q: What's the difference between paint protection film (PPF) and vinyl wraps? +
A: Paint protection film (PPF) is a clear or glossy film designed to protect your vehicle's paint from rock chips, scratches, and UV damage while maintaining the original color. Vinyl wraps are used to change your vehicle's appearance with custom colors, finishes, or graphics. PPF protects, vinyl wraps customize—many customers use both together.
Q: How do I choose the right window tint shade (VLT percentage)? +
A: VLT (Visible Light Transmission) indicates how much light passes through—lower numbers mean darker tint. Common choices: 5% (limo dark), 20% (dark), 35% (medium), 50% (light). Check your state's legal limits: most allow 70% on front windshield strip, 35-50% on front side windows, and any darkness on rear windows. We recommend 20-35% for rear windows and 35-50% for front sides in most states.
